Commercial Description:
For years, we've been telling you that great taste grows on trees -- apple trees that is. But just across the orchard we discovered another kind of great taste. We went out on a limb and created Woodchuck Pear Cider, a crisply refreshing drink with the tantalizing essence of pear. You can buy it in 6-packs or on draft.
